A well-established demolition and earthworks contractor is seeking a dedicated Assistant Quantity Surveyor to join their commercial team. This is a full-time, office-based position in Eversley, Hampshire, with regular travel to a range of sites varying in size, complexity, and location.

Key Responsibilities:

*

Preparing applications for payment, including valuations of variations and loss and/or expense claims

*

Agreeing interim payment amounts with clients and monitoring payment notices (due, received, or outstanding)

*

Assisting in the preparation of project budgets alongside Contracts Managers and the Operations Director

*

Monitoring budgets against costs and monthly projections

*

Issuing subcontractor enquiries, analysing quotations, placing orders, processing interim payments, and agreeing final accounts

*

Ensuring contractual obligations are met in full

*

Advising Contracts Managers on commercial matters such as variations and delays, ensuring they are identified and recorded

*

Assisting in the preparation of contractual notices, including EWNs, NCEs and EOT requests

*

Conducting regular site visits to identify potential variations and to ensure accurate site records are maintained

*

Building and maintaining strong working relationships with clients, consultants, and internal teams
